What is the difference between Part Time Store Associate vs Part Time Cashier?

AspectPart Time Store AssociatePart Time Cashier
ResponsibilitiesAssisting customers, stocking shelves, maintaining store appearanceProcessing transactions, handling payments, providing customer service at checkout
Required SkillsCustomer service, communication, basic product knowledgeCash handling, POS system operation, customer service
Work EnvironmentRetail store, various departmentsCheckout counters, retail store
Common UsageGeneral retail support rolesFront-end cashier positions

While both roles involve customer interaction in retail settings, a Part Time Store Associate has broader responsibilities like stocking and assisting customers across departments, whereas a Part Time Cashier primarily focuses on processing transactions at the checkout. Both positions require strong customer service skills and are essential for retail operations.

What is a part time store associate?

Part-time store associates are retail employees who work fewer hours than full-time staff, typically less than 30-35 hours per week. Their primary responsibilities include assisting customers, stocking shelves, operating cash registers, and maintaining store cleanliness. Part-time associates often have flexible schedules, making this role popular among students, parents, or individuals seeking supplemental income. They play an essential role in providing customer service and supporting daily store operations.

How does a part time store associate typically collaborate with other team members during a shift?

Part Time Store Associates work closely with other associates, supervisors, and managers to ensure smooth store operations. Collaboration often involves communicating about restocking needs, assisting with customer inquiries, and coordinating tasks such as organizing displays or maintaining cleanliness. Team members may rotate responsibilities throughout the shift, so flexibility and good communication are key to keeping the workflow efficient. This teamwork helps ensure that customers receive prompt service and the store remains well-organized.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a part time store associ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Part Time Store Associate, you need strong customer service skills, basic math abilities, and often a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, inventory management tools, and cash handling procedures is typically required. Reliability, teamwork, and effective communication help associates stand out in fast-paced retail environments. These skills are crucial for delivering excellent customer experiences, maintaining store operations, and supporting overall sales success.

Job description

Location: LaSalle, Ontario

Job Description:

The Pet Valu family of stores includes Pet Valu, Paulmac's Pet Food, Bosley's, Tisol and Total Pet and together we are one of the largest retail operations in North America dedicated to providing families with food and supplies for dogs, cats, companion birds, wild birds, fish, reptiles and small animals.

All of our stores are dedicated to helping local pets in need, and we partner with local shelters, rescues and charities for adoption events, in-store adoption (select stores only) and pet food bank programs, as well as through our national donation drives and fundraising campaigns.

At Pet Valu, we're Pet Experts, and we're pet lovers, too.

Job Overview:

As a Sales Associate you will use your knowledge and experience to help Pet Parents find the right nutrition and other solutions for their pets. You will be part of a team of passionate Pet Experts, and enjoy the perks of helping Pet Parents every day. If you are enthusiastic about learning and growing with one of the top pet retailers in North America, this position is for you!

Wage: $17.60 per hour

What you get:

  • Staff Discounts
  • Retail Training
  • Competitive Wages
  • Pet Care Knowledge
  • Flexible Scheduling

What you do:

  • Cashier and customer sales
  • Preparing merchandise orders, banking and other miscellaneous paperwork
  • Placing small items (under 10 lbs) including pet supplies, household items, etc. into stock in the sales area of the store
  • Sweeping, dusting and other general store maintenance functions
  • Assist in unloading delivery vehicles of cases and bags of pet food and supplies and putting these into stock (items up to 50 lbs.)
  • Other duties and tasks as required

What you bring:

  • Previous retail or customer service experience
  • Working knowledge of POS system
  • Possess outgoing and friendly personality with strong customer service skills
  • Ability to lift 50lbs repetitively
  • Ability to work as scheduled to meet attendance requirements, which may include weekends and evenings
  • Ability to have reliable means of transportation to and from the store
